Design Notes: What Every Designer Should Check
Before using Life is Better with a Chihuahua Svg for a client project, there are several practical considerations. Test it in black and white to see how it holds up without color. Check contrast on both light and dark backgrounds to ensure visibility. Preview it at small and large sizes to confirm scalability.
Place it on real mockups to see how it interacts with other elements. Test print quality to ensure the resolution meets expectations. Review the file formats—SVG, EPS, DXF, PDF, PNG, and JPG—to make sure they align with your workflow. If transparency is involved, inspect the PNG design carefully.
Compare it with different font styles to see how it pairs with serif, sans serif, script, handwritten, or display fonts. Confirm commercial licensing to avoid legal issues when using it for a client or business project.
